What Is a Faucet Seat Washer and How Does It Work?

A faucet seat washer is a small, circular component found within a faucet that helps create a watertight seal when the faucet is turned off. Typically made of rubber or a similar flexible material, the washer presses against the faucet seat, which is the part of the faucet that the washer covers to prevent leaks. When the faucet is turned on, the washer lifts away from the seat, allowing water to flow through, and when turned off, it presses back against the seat to stop the water flow.

According to the International Plumbing Code, faucet seat washers play a crucial role in maintaining the efficiency and functionality of plumbing fixtures by preventing water leaks, which can lead to increased water bills and environmental waste. Leaky faucets can waste more than 3,000 gallons of water per year, highlighting the importance of these small components in maintaining household water efficiency.

Key aspects of faucet seat washers include their various sizes and types, which must match the specific faucet model to ensure proper sealing. Over time, these washers can wear out due to constant friction and exposure to water, leading to leaks when they no longer provide an effective seal. Regular maintenance and replacement of faucet seat washers are essential for preventing water wastage and maintaining optimal faucet performance. Additionally, the material of the washer affects its durability; rubber washers are common, but other materials like silicone or felt may offer longer-lasting solutions.

Why Is It Important to Choose the Right Faucet Seat Washer?

Choosing the right faucet seat washer is crucial because it directly impacts the faucet’s functionality, longevity, and the prevention of leaks.

According to the American Society of Home Inspectors, the correct washer size and material can significantly reduce the likelihood of leaks and water wastage, which are common issues in plumbing systems (ASHI, 2021). An inappropriate washer can lead to improper sealing, resulting in drips and increased water bills.

The underlying mechanism involves the washer’s ability to create a tight seal against the faucet seat. When a washer is too thick or too thin, or made from an incompatible material, it can fail to compress adequately or may wear out quickly, leading to gaps where water can escape. This failure not only causes inconvenience but can also result in more severe plumbing issues, such as corrosion or water damage to surrounding structures over time. The right washer ensures optimal compression and durability, minimizing the risk of future repairs and leaks.

What Are the Different Types of Faucet Seat Washers Available?

The different types of faucet seat washers include:

  • Rubber Washers: Rubber washers are the most common type used in faucets, known for their flexibility and ability to create a tight seal. They are typically used in compression faucets and are available in various sizes to fit different models, making them an economical option for many households.
  • O-Ring Washers: O-ring washers provide a circular sealing surface that is effective in preventing leaks in faucet assemblies. Made from durable materials like rubber or silicone, these washers are often used in cartridge faucets and can withstand higher pressure compared to standard rubber washers.
  • Disc Washers: Disc washers are flat and made of materials such as rubber or plastic, designed to work specifically with disc faucets. They offer a reliable seal and are often preferred for their long-lasting performance, reducing the frequency of replacement.
  • Ceramic Washers: Ceramic washers are a more durable option made from ceramic materials, which are resistant to wear and tear. They are typically found in high-end faucets and offer excellent sealing capabilities, making them ideal for areas with hard water that can cause mineral buildup.
  • Compression Washers: Compression washers are designed for use in faucets that require a compression mechanism to function properly. They are thicker than standard washers and are made from materials that compress under pressure, ensuring a tight seal and minimizing the risk of leaks.

How Can You Identify the Correct Size for Your Faucet Seat Washer?

Identifying the correct size for your faucet seat washer is essential for ensuring a proper seal and preventing leaks.

  • Measure the Old Washer: Remove the old washer and measure its diameter using calipers or a ruler.
  • Consult Manufacturer Specifications: Look up the faucet model online or in the manual for the manufacturer’s recommended washer size.
  • Use a Washer Size Chart: Refer to a washer size chart that provides dimensions based on common faucet types.
  • Test Fit Different Sizes: If unsure, purchase a variety pack of washers to test fit them in your faucet.

Measure the Old Washer: Start by removing the old washer from the faucet. Using precise measuring tools like calipers will give you an accurate diameter, which is crucial for finding a matching replacement. Ensure to measure both the outer and inner diameters, as well as the thickness.

Consult Manufacturer Specifications: If you have the original packaging or a user manual, you can find the exact specifications for the washer size. Many manufacturers provide detailed part lists that include washer sizes, making it easier to order the correct part without guesswork.

Use a Washer Size Chart: Various online resources and home improvement guides provide charts that correlate faucet types and sizes with specific washer dimensions. These charts can be particularly helpful if your faucet is a common model or brand, streamlining the process of finding the right washer size.

Test Fit Different Sizes: Sometimes, the best way to ensure a proper fit is through trial and error. Purchasing a variety pack of washers allows you to test different sizes directly in your faucet, ensuring you find the right one that provides a good seal without leaks.

What Signs Indicate It’s Time to Replace Your Faucet Seat Washer?

Several signs can indicate it’s time to replace your faucet seat washer:

  • Leaking Faucet: If you notice water dripping from your faucet even when it’s turned off, this could suggest that the washer is worn out and no longer creates a proper seal.
  • Low Water Pressure: A decrease in water flow can occur if the faucet seat washer is damaged or clogged, as it may prevent water from flowing freely through the system.
  • Unusual Sounds: If you hear a hissing or whistling sound when using the faucet, it may indicate that air is escaping due to a faulty washer that isn’t sealing correctly.
  • Corrosion or Wear: Inspecting the faucet seat washer can reveal visible signs of wear, such as cracks or fraying, which clearly suggest that replacement is necessary for proper function.
  • Frequent Adjustments: If you find yourself constantly adjusting the faucet handle to stop leaks or achieve desired flow rates, this can be a sign that the washer is no longer effective and should be replaced.

Leaking faucets are often a primary indicator of a failing washer, as they occur when the seal is compromised. Water drips can lead to increased water bills and wastage, making timely replacement essential.

Low water pressure can be frustrating and can stem from a damaged washer that disrupts normal flow. A thorough check of the washer can help identify if it is a contributing factor to the reduced pressure.

Unusual sounds like hissing or whistling can indicate that air is getting into the plumbing system due to the washer failing to seal properly. This not only affects performance but can also lead to further issues down the line.

Visible signs of corrosion or wear on the washer can be an immediate red flag that it is time for a replacement. Regular inspections can help catch these issues early and maintain faucet efficiency.

Frequent adjustments to the faucet handle suggest that the washer is not functioning effectively, leading to user frustration. This behavior can indicate that the washer is either too old or damaged and requires attention to restore proper function.
